SDG-Aligned Research Themes

International Conference on Chronic Kidney Disease and Management conference tracks support global knowledge exchange, innovation, and sustainable development priorities across diverse disciplines.

SDG 2 - Zero Hunger SDG 3 - Good Health and Well-being SDG 4 - Quality Education SDG 9 - Industry, Innovation and Infrastructure

This track will focus on the latest findings in chronic kidney disease research, highlighting novel biomarkers and pathophysiological mechanisms. Participants will explore the implications of these advancements for early diagnosis and intervention.

This session will examine cutting-edge strategies in kidney care, including personalized medicine and patient-centered approaches. Discussions will center on how these innovations can improve patient outcomes and quality of life.

This track will delve into the latest advancements in dialysis techniques, including home dialysis and wearable technology. Experts will discuss the impact of these innovations on patient management and adherence.

Participants will explore the evolving landscape of renal replacement therapy, including transplantation and dialysis options. The session will address challenges and opportunities in optimizing therapy for patients with end-stage renal disease.

This track will investigate the relationship between kidney function and the progression of chronic kidney disease. Presentations will cover risk factors, monitoring strategies, and interventions aimed at slowing disease advancement.

This session will focus on the critical role of nutrition in managing chronic kidney disease. Experts will discuss dietary interventions and their impact on kidney health and overall patient well-being.

This track will highlight the importance of patient education and self-management strategies in nephrology. Discussions will center on empowering patients to take an active role in their kidney health.

Participants will explore the latest pharmacological developments in the treatment of chronic kidney disease. The session will cover novel drugs, their mechanisms of action, and clinical implications.

This track will address the psychosocial challenges faced by patients with chronic kidney disease. Experts will discuss strategies for improving mental health and social support in this population.

This session will examine the impact of health disparities on kidney disease management and outcomes. Participants will explore strategies to address these disparities and improve access to care.

This track will focus on emerging research areas in nephrology, including regenerative medicine and gene therapy. Participants will discuss the potential of these innovations to transform kidney disease management.
